Description:
3-Formyl-2,5-dihydro-2,2,5,5-tetramethyl-4-(3-pyridinyl)-1H-pyrrol-1-yloxy, identified by its CAS number 1379779-16-4, is a complex organic compound characterized by its unique structural features. It contains a pyrrol-1-yloxy moiety, which contributes to its potential biological activity. The presence of a formyl group indicates that it may participate in various chemical reactions, such as condensation or oxidation. The tetramethyl substitution suggests a bulky structure, which could influence its solubility and reactivity. Additionally, the incorporation of a pyridine ring may enhance its interaction with biological targets, making it of interest in medicinal chemistry. The compound's properties, such as melting point, boiling point, and solubility, would depend on its specific molecular interactions and the presence of functional groups. Overall, this compound's intricate structure and functional groups suggest potential applications in pharmaceuticals or as a chemical intermediate in organic synthesis. Further studies would be necessary to fully elucidate its properties and potential uses.
